Integrating therapeutic approaches for online care
Christine Perez draws on client-centered therapy to place each person's goals and values at the center of care, creating space for clients to explore concerns at their own pace while the therapist provides empathy and reflective listening.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, another frequent component of her work, focuses on identifying patterns of thinking and behavior that contribute to distress and teaching practical skills to reduce anxiety, manage mood, and improve daily functioning. Mindfulness therapy is used to help clients build present-moment awareness and stress management skills, which can be especially helpful for anxiety, rumination, and emotional regulation.Choosing the right approach is part of the therapeutic process and Christine collaborates with each client to determine which methods fit their needs, goals, and preferences. She adapts strategies over time so treatment stays relevant and effective as circumstances change.
